Adding Printers. The following procedure is an example for Windows 10. In the operating system's setting screen, select Devices > Printers & scanners > Add a printer or scanner, and then add your printer. Page top.

In the right-pane, click on Add a Printer or Scanner option.To add a printer in PowerShell, follow these steps: 1. Open PowerShell with admin rights. 2. Run the command Get-Printer to find a list of available printers. 3. Use Add-Printer -Name “PrinterName” to add the printer. 4. Set the printer as the default using Set-PrintDefault -Name “PrinterName”.Open Settings > click on Devices Icon > On the next screen, select Printers & Scanners in the left pane. The most common solution for sharing a printer (because of the ease and price) is to connect it to a host computer. Essentially, the host computer "shares" the printer by allowing other computers on the network to print through it over a LAN (local area network) or Internet connection.Then click Add a Printer. Jan 9, 2024 · Step 1: Verify Printer Compatibility. Check if your printer supports AirPrint. AirPrint is Apple’s wireless printing technology, which allows iOS devices to print wirelessly without the need for printer-specific drivers. Before attempting to add a printer to your iPhone, ensure that your printer is AirPrint-compatible. For more information about printers and our fantastic selection of deals, visit the ...To choose a default printer: Select Start > Settings . Go to Bluetooth & devices > Printers & scanners > select a printer. Then select Set as default. If you don't see the Set as default option, the Let Windows manage my default printer option may be selected. You'll need to clear that selection before you can choose a default printer on your own. Downloading and running the setup file to install the drivers and software ( download here), , Adding a Printer Manually on Windows. Go to the Start menu, and choose Devices and Printers. Toward the top left of the dialogue that appears select Add A Printer. Select Add a Local Printer. NOTE: This is the counter intuitive part. Even though the printer is indeed a networked printer, you must add it as a LOCAL printer., From the right pane, under the Add printers & scanners section, click Add a printer or scanner. This video walks you through the process step by step, pointing out common pitfalls alon..., Go to Control Panel > Network and Sharing Center > Advanced sharing settings > Turn on file and printer sharing > Save Changes. Go to Printers and Scanners. Right-click the computer, select Printer properties, and check off Share this printer on the Sharing tab.
